How to Choose the Right Balcony Grill Design For Your Home

balcony grill design

Choosing the right balcony grill design for your home is an important choice that requires weighing safety, looks, and usefulness. Here is a step-by-step plan to help you get through the process and choose the best grill design:

Evaluate Your Safety Needs: 

To begin with, evaluate your safety needs. Consider whether you have kids or pets, how high your balcony is, and any other safety worries you may have.

If safety is important, choose a grill with small gaps between the bars so that pets or children can’t escape. Select a full-cover balcony grill design for extra protection.

Figure Out Your Aesthetic Tastes:

Take some time to consider your home’s architectural style and the look you want to achieve with your balcony design. Look for ideas in fashion magazines, the web, and social media sites. Compare various styles, finishes, and materials to find one that suits your tastes.

Think About Your Material Choices:

Different materials can be used to make balcony grills, each with pros and cons.

Aluminium Balcony Grill: Aluminum balcony grills are popular for modern homes because they are strong, lightweight, and don’t rust. They can be used in various ways and don’t need much upkeep.

Iron Balcony Grill: Iron balcony grills are made of iron, look beautiful and strong, and will never go out of style on a porch. But they might need regular upkeep to keep them from rusting.

Steel Balcony Grill: Steel balcony grills are a flexible choice for modern homes because they are strong and look good. They last a long time and don’t need much upkeep, so you can enjoy them for a long time.

Style and Design: 

Consider the style and design features that suit your taste and complement your home’s architecture.

Full-cover designs: These designs offer the most security and privacy, so they’re great for flats or places with many people.

Modern Designs: Designs that are sleek and simple, with clean lines and few details, that go well with modern buildings.

Glass Inserts: Use balcony front glass grill design to attract the view of the visitors. Choose glass panels to make a stylish clear barrier that doesn’t compromise safety. Glass panels let in more natural light and let you see clearly.

Ensure Compliance with Building Codes

Before making a final choice, ensure the outdoor grill you want to use is designed to meet all local safety and building codes. To ensure the safety of your balcony, check the standards for height, the distance between bars, and the structure as a whole.

Ask a Professional:  If you need help determining which outdoor grill design is best for your home, ask a builder, designer, or contractor. They can give you expert advice based on your wants and needs.

Review Your Budget: Consider your budget when choosing a balcony grill design. There are many different prices for balcony grills, so picking a style that fits your budget is important.

You can choose the right balcony grill design for your home if you follow these steps and consider your safety needs, style tastes, material options, and budget.

10 Modern Balcony Grill Designs For Your Home

cosy balcony design

Modern grill design for balcony full-covers your home to look elegant and stylish. It combines good looks with usefulness, making outdoor areas safer and more creative. Here are some modern ways to make your balcony look better:

1. Minimalist Metal Grills: 

Modern buildings look good with sleek, simple metal grills in black or silver tones. Choose simple shapes and straight lines to give your porch a touch of class.

2. Glass Barriers with Metal Accents: 

Mix glass panels with metal details for a stylish and airy look. This design not only keeps you safe but also lets you see more from your porch, making it feel bigger.

3. Vertical Gardens with Integrated Grills: 

Add greenery to your outdoor grill design by adding vertical gardens. These growing walls add a nice touch of nature and keep people out. Include the grill in the design to make it look like it fits perfectly.

4. Foldable or Sliding Grills: 

Depending on your taste, choose grills that fold up or slide open and shut easily. This gives you the freedom to enjoy an open porch on nice days and close it up when you need to.

5. LED-lit Grills: 

Adding LED-lit grills to your deck will make it look amazing at night. By changing the lighting, you can set the mood and improve the atmosphere of your outdoor space.

6. Customised Laser-Cut Designs: 

Add intricate laser-cut designs or motifs that show off your style and personality to make your balcony grill your own. There are many different ways to create a unique focus point, from abstract designs to patterns based on nature.

7. Multi-Functional Grills: 

Choose grills that can be used for multiple purposes, like ones with built-in seats or storage. This will make the most of the room on your balcony while keeping the overall look consistent.

8. Wood and Metal Combination: 

Mix warm wood elements with smooth metal finishes for a modern but warm outdoor grill design. This mix of materials gives the area structure and visual interest, making it a nice place to relax outside.

9. Smart Grills with Remote Control: 

Get a smart grill that you can control with your phone even when you’re not nearby. It’s easy to change the grill’s settings or open and close it, which gives you peace of mind and comfort.

10. Balcony Safety Grill Designs or Mesh Screens: 

If you have kids or pets on your balcony, add safety nets, mesh screens, and grills to keep them safer. Pick see-through materials to keep things secure and visible.
